SMS

EPF account balance can be checked by sending an SMS to 7738299899 from the registered mobile number. The format for sending the message is ‘EPFOHO UAN ENG’ where ENG is the three characters of the language you prefer. The language facility is available in ten vernacular languages, i.e. (English, Hindi, Telugu, Punjabi, Gujarati, Marathi, Malayalam, Tamil, Kannada, and Bengali). There is a probability that you may not receive a message if your Aadhaar, PAN and bank account were provided by the employer and were not digitally approved. In such an instance, you must contact your employer immediately. When the message has been successfully accepted, an SMS is received from EPFO which states the KYC document details; the last contribution made and the balance in the account.

UMANG App

The UMANG app also has access to the EPFO account. Follow these steps to check the account balance on your app:

1. Download the app on your phone;

2. Select the EPFO option on the app;

3. Click on ‘Employee Centric Service’ option;

4. Enter the UAN of the account holder;

5. An OTP is received on the registered mobile number;

6. To proceed further, enter the OTP received.

7. Click on ‘view passbook’ under the EPFO option.

MISSED Call

To be able to check the account balance by giving a missed call, the account holder must ensure that the KYC details have been linked and integrated with the UAN. When the KYC has been successfully linked you may give a missed call to 011-22901406 from your registered number and an SMS containing details of the EPFO will soon be dispatched.

FAQ?

Q. How big is UAN?

The UAN is a 12-digit number.


Q. How to check UAN status?

To check your UAN status, you must log on here and fill all the requested details and submit.


Q. Who allots UAN?

The Employees’ Provident Fund Organisation (EPFO) allocates the UAN for all subscribers.

Q. Should I mandatorily withdraw from EPF once I retire?

It is not compulsory to withdraw the entire accumulated amount from the EPF account. However, the account will not accrue any more interest after three months of not receiving any contributions.
